Ryzen 3 3300X vs Core i7-930 specs and performance
According to the hardwareDB Benchmark tool, the Ryzen 3 3300X is faster than the Core i7-930. Furthermore, our gaming benchmark shows that it also outperforms the Core i7-930 in all gaming tests too.
Info from our database shows that they both have the same core count and the same number of threads. Our comparison shows that the Ryzen 3 3300X has a slightly higher clock speed compared to the Core i7-930. Also, the Ryzen 3 3300X has a slightly higher turbo speed. A Ryzen 3 3300X CPU outputs less heat than a Core i7-930 CPU because of its significantly lower TDP. This measures the amount of heat they output and can be used to estimate power consumption.
Most CPUs have more threads than cores. This technology, colloquially called hyperthreading, improves performance by splitting a core into multiple virtual ones. This provides more efficient utilisation of a core. Indeed, the Ryzen 3 3300X has more threads than cores. Each physical core is split into multiple threads.
